Ostarine (MK-2866)
Ostarine, often referred to as MK-2866, is one of the most well-known SARMs on the market. It is favored for its ability to improve lean muscle mass, enhance strength, and aid in fat loss. Ostarine is believed to have fewer side effects compared to traditional steroids, making it an appealing option for athletes and bodybuilders. Many users report experiencing increased endurance and improved recovery time when taking Ostarine.
Ligandrol (LGD-4033)
Ligandrol, also known as LGD-4033, is another popular SARM that has gained a significant following in the fitness community. It is praised for its ability to promote lean muscle mass and increase strength. Ligandrol has shown promising results in clinical trials, with individuals experiencing improved body composition and enhanced athletic performance. It is important to note that Ligandrol is not approved for human use and is only available for research purposes.
Andarine (S4)
Andarine, commonly known as S4, is a SARM that is known for its potential to promote muscle growth and aid in fat loss. It is often used by individuals looking to achieve a more shredded and vascular appearance. Andarine is known for its binding affinity to androgen receptors in the skeletal muscle and bone tissue, leading to increased protein synthesis and muscle development. However, it is essential to consult a healthcare professional before using Andarine due to its potential side effects.
Cardarine (GW-501516)
Cardarine, also referred to as GW-501516, is a SARM that is often mistaken for a fat burner. However, it does not directly affect fat cells like traditional fat burners do. Instead, Cardarine works by increasing the expression of genes involved in fatty acid oxidation, leading to enhanced endurance and fat loss. It has gained popularity among endurance athletes who aim to improve their stamina and endurance during training. It is important to note that Cardarine is currently a prohibited substance in professional sports.
